I love a good belif moisturizing moment but I do so hate the alcohol that comes along with it. Lucky enough, the new belif Aqua Bomb Depuffing Eye Gel with Caffeine + Hyaluronic Acid has landed sans alcohol but loaded up with plenty of ingredients to hydrate, brighten, and fight puffy eyes. This is formulated with caffeine, hyaluronic acid, and niacinamide and has a cooling sensation when applied.

Caffeine is a well known way to depuff the under eye area and Hyaluronic Acid is a great way to help to retain moisture under eyes. This also, contains Vitamin C as well as Niacinamide to brighten dark circles. Plus Adenosine and Clean Collagen that act to plump and improve elasticity. It has a slanted applicator for easy application. Belif eye creams are actually very good and quite moisturizing. Although, some of their products are formulated with alcohol which can be very drying. I’m happy to say this eye gel doesn’t contain any.
